## Escalation: Flaky integration tests (Lumenpay)

If the Lumenpay settlement suite fails twice in a row on unchanged code, mark the run as flaky and open a triage ticket. Do not bypass the signing checks to unblock a deploy. For audit questions or to request test logs, reach the payments QA rotation here.

escalation mailbox, yajeg-bageg: quenax.olidor@lumiccorp.internal

Subject: Handover — Scanline integration release duties

Hi Verity,

Handing over release management for the Scanline barcode scanner integration while I'm out. Builds come off the Kettleworth runner, get signed, then ship to the Drossmere registry. For your security review: the firmware bridge is the sensitive bit, since the scanner vendor validates our signature on their side too. Rotation happened two weeks ago, so older docs show a stale identity. The signing key currently in use is pasted below for your records.

release key, fajef-kajeg: bky19_LdLu6Ne6FLi8he2c24d

**Q: RateLens parity checker stopped pulling competitor rates — what now?**

First, don't panic. Nine times out of ten the Brindlewick Suites feed just timed out and the worker is sulking. Restart the `parity-poll` job and watch the dashboard for five minutes. If the vault holding the feed credentials is sealed, you'll need to unseal it manually. Use the recovery passphrase below.

unlock words, fafop-hawep: briwyn-oliix-sorox

Account Recovery — Slimline Images (Porthaven Build Team). When a support account on the Krellix registry is locked, recovery is tied to the image-slimming pipeline owner role. The slimmed base images strip the PAM helpers, so recovery must be run from the full debug image, not the distroless variant. Pull the debug tag, start a shell, and invoke the recovery tool with the locked username. The tool will prompt for the passphrase shown below.

vault phrase of bagaf-kajeg = jorath-feniel-briir-siliel-ralix